Why is channel 1 not HD on sky?
Channels 1 to 5 on UK terrestrial broadcasts have been allocated as BBC1, BBC2, ITV, Channel4 and Channel 5 respectively. These channel numbers have been accepted as the norm for decades.
When cable and satellite broadcasts were first started in the UK, providers wanted to promote their own channels by using the channel 1 slot. The regulators have instructed all broadcasters to retain the traditional numbers for the first 5 channels. Therefore, HD channels must be somewhere other than those first 5 channel numbers. No doubt, this will change in the future when HD becomes the norm for television rather than the exception.

What does a HDMI audio and video cable do?
HDMI is a type of video interface developed to carry high definition video signals. Additionally, HDMI will support standard definition video and carries audio as part of the signal. The cable provides a convenient method of carrying video, audio and control signals between devices without the need to use multiple wires.
HDMI is also compatible with DVI, a video display interface for computer displays. Unlike HDMI, DVI does not handle audio so the compatibility is limited to video only.
HDMI supports an encoding system known as HDCP. The encoding is designed to prevent unauthorized copying of video content and increasingly commercial content is using the protection system.

Can you connect Blu-ray player to a standard DVD player then to a HDTV?
If the DVD player has a video pass through function, then yes. If the feature is available, there will be an HDMI input to the DVD player as well as an HDMI output.
If the feature is available with analog connections, then the Bluray player can be connected only with standard definition signals, losing the benefit of its HD capability.

How do you hook up a Wii to a HDTV?
Using the composite cables (yellow, white, red) that are provided with the Wii. You also have the ability to purchase a component cable (red, green blue & red white) and connect them to the TV accordingly. Some newer HDTV's may not have a composite input so you may need the component cable. Some may also have the green component input double as the yellow composite input. I have seen this primarily on Samsung TV's.
